General Interest

JAMES/RADFORD
Teamed up in 2021 coming out of retirement. Originally wanted to skate only in shows. "When I retired and even up to shortly before I started with Vanessa, I would have never ever imagined that I would come back. I truly felt my skating career is complete. It was just by luck and by chance that that opportunity came to skate with Vanessa. We skated together for a few days and at the end of like five days, we could do a triple twist and throw triples and we felt maybe we should show the world what we can do rather than just do shows. And that was when the idea of us actually doing competitions started.” (isuresults.com; Radford, isu.org, 3 Jan 2022)

DUHAMEL/RADFORD
Competed with Meagan Duhamel 2010-18, winning with her three Olympic medals (gold and silver in the team 2018 and 2014, bronze in the individual event 2018) as well as four world medals (gold in 2015 and 2016, bronze in 2013 and 2014).

MUSICIAN AND COMPOSER
Plays the piano and has composed music that he and other skaters skated to: "Tribute" (used by Duhamel/Radford in the 2013/14 season), "A Journey" (used by Patrick Chan (CAN) 2016/17 season), "Storm" (used by Kamila Valieva (ROC) 2020/21 season). (sportsnet.ca; isuresults.com)

PREVIOUS PARTNERSHIP
Skated with Sarah Burke 2003-2005 and with Rachel Kirkland 2006-08. Competed with Anne-Marie Giroux in the 2009/10 season.

SINGLE SKATING
Competed at the international junior level in single skating 2002-04 before switching to pair skating.

Milestones

OLYMPIC GAMES
2018 Olympic team event champion and bronze medallist in the individual event (with Duhamel).
2014 Olympic team event silver medallist (with Duhamel), placed 7th in the individual event.

WORLD CHAMPIONSHIPS
2015 and 2016 world champion (with Duhamel).
2013 and 2014 world bronze medallists (with Duhamel).
Competed at world championships 2011-17.

FOUR CONTINENTS CHAMPIONSHIPS
2013 and 2015 Four Continents champion (with Duhamel).
2011 and 2017 Four Continents silver medallist (with Duhamel).

First openly gay man to win a gold medal a the Olympic Winter Games (2018 Olympic Figure skating team event). (thestar.com, 14 Feb 2018)
